Ingredients

To create these scrumptious bacon wrapped jalapeno poppers, gather the following ingredients:

For the Poppers

  • 12 large jalapeno peppers
  • 8 oz cream cheese (softened)
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 12 slices of bacon
  • 1/4 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/4 tsp onion pow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ste

How to Make Bacon Wrapped Jalapeno Poppers

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) to ensure it’s hot enough for crispy results.

Step 2: Prepare the Jalapenos

  • Halve the jalapenos lengthwise.
  • Carefully remove the seeds using a knife or spoon. This helps reduce the heat level if desired.

Step 3: Make the Cheese Filling

In a mixing bowl:
* Combine soft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. Mix until smooth.

Step 4: Fill the Jalapenos

Fill each halved jalapeno generously with the cheese mixture using a spoon or spatula.

Step 5: Wrap with Bacon

Take half a slice of bacon:
* Wrap it around each stuffed jalapeno popper.
* Secure with toothpicks if needed to hold everything together.

Step 6: Bake the Poppers

Place the prepared poppers on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per:
* Bake for 20-25 minutes until the bacon is crispy and golden brown.

Step 7: Broil for Extra Crispiness (Optional)

For even crispier bacon:
* Broil in your oven for an additional 2-3 minutes at the end of baking.

Step 8: Cool Before Serving

Let them cool slightly before serving. Enjoy these tasty bacon wrapped jalapeno poppers as a crowd-favorite appetizer!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Avoiding common mistakes can elevate your Bacon Wrapped Jalapeno Poppers to the next level. Here are some pitfalls and how to steer clear of them:

  • Boldly Underfilling: Don’t skimp on the cheese filling. Ensure each jalapeno half is generously filled for maximum flavor.
  • Ignoring Jalapeno Size: Using smaller jalapenos can lead to uneven cooking. Choose large, firm peppers for consistent results.
  • Neglecting Bacon Quality: Low-quality bacon may not crisp up nicely. Opt for thick-cut bacon for a better texture and taste.
  • Skipping the Cooling Time: Serving immediately can lead to scalding bites. Let them cool slightly before serving for better enjoyment.
  • Inconsistent Oven Temperature: An oven that’s not preheated correctly can result in soggy bacon. Always preheat your oven before baking.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store leftover Bacon Wrapped Jalapeno Poppers in an airtight container.
  • They will keep well in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

Freezing Bacon Wrapped Jalapeno Poppers

  • Wrap each popper individually in plastic wrap before placing them in a freezer-safe bag.
  • You can freeze them for up to 2 months.

Reheating Bacon Wrapped Jalapeno Poppers

  •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 10-15 minutes until warmed through and crispy.
  • Microwave: Heat on medium power for 1-2 minutes, but this may soften the bacon.
  • Stovetop: Heat in a skillet over medium heat for about 5 minutes, turning occasionally until heated through.

Can I make Bacon Wrapped Jalapeno Poppers 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are them ahead by filling the jalapenos and wrapping them with bacon. Store them in the refrigerator until you’re ready to bake.

How spicy are these Bacon Wrapped Jalapeno Poppers?

The spice level depends largely on the type of jalapenos used. For milder poppers, choose green jalapenos and remove all seeds and membranes.

Can I use turkey bacon instead?

Absolutely! Turkey bacon is a great alternative if you’re looking for a lighter option, though it might not get as crispy as traditional bacon.
